Best UPS for Home Assistant: Battery Backup Sizing
A UPS for Home Assistant should protect the automation path, not just the computer. If the server stays up but the router, Ethernet switch, Zigbee network coordinator or PoE Bluetooth proxy loses power, automations can still fail. The useful sizing inputs are real watts and required ride-through time. VA is a compatibility limit, not a promise of runtime, so this guide uses load and energy estimates before pointing you to current UPS classes.

What this smart-home infrastructure needs
For a small Home Assistant appliance plus router and switch, a 600–1000VA UPS can be a reasonable starting class; a Proxmox server, PoE switch, NVR or local-AI GPU can push the requirement toward 1000–1500VA or beyond. Measure the combined watts, keep headroom below the UPS watt rating, and check the manufacturer runtime curve at your real load.

Back up the automation path, not one box
Home Assistant depends on more than the host. A router, core switch, network coordinator, Bluetooth proxy or access point may be required for a command to reach a device. List those dependencies before buying the UPS. Keeping a mini PC alive while the network switch goes dark provides little practical resilience, so the protected load should represent the minimum functioning smart-home path.
Watts and VA answer different questions
UPS products advertise volt-amperes and watts because both electrical limits matter. Your equipment consumes watts, and the UPS must support that real power without operating at its ceiling. VA is not a runtime rating. Two 1500VA units can have different batteries and runtime curves. Size the load against the watt rating first, then use the manufacturer runtime chart for the desired minutes.
Runtime is fundamentally an energy problem
A rough planning check multiplies protected watts by desired hours, then adds conversion and aging margin. That gives a minimum usable energy target, not a guarantee. UPS batteries deliver less usable energy at high load, and vendors use different battery designs. Small Home Assistant appliances need less UPS than gaming PCs
Home Assistant Green, a low-power mini PC, router and modest switch can have a surprisingly small combined load. In that case a compact 600–1000VA class unit can provide useful ride-through without buying an oversized tower. Measure actual wall power if possible. The calculation becomes much more accurate once you stop using desktop-PC assumptions for a 10–40 watt automation server.
Proxmox and local AI change the power class
A Proxmox host running Home Assistant, Frigate and Ollama may draw much more than a dedicated automation appliance, especially if it includes multiple hard drives or a discrete GPU. Size the UPS for the actual combined peak you intend to keep online. If the goal is only a graceful shutdown, runtime can be shorter; if local cameras and automations must continue, battery capacity becomes more important.
PoE can dominate the protected load
A PoE switch may power cameras, access points and Bluetooth proxies. The switch’s own electronics are only part of the UPS load; downstream PoE devices also consume battery energy. For a Frigate-heavy home, camera infrared LEDs, heaters or PTZ motors can push worst-case power well above idle. Use the critical PoE load rather than the switch’s empty-chassis power when estimating battery requirements.
Home Assistant NUT monitoring needs a NUT server
The Network UPS Tools integration in Home Assistant consumes data from a NUT server. The USB/serial/network UPS driver still has to run somewhere, such as Home Assistant OS through an add-on or another host on the network. Once connected, supported UPSes can expose charge, runtime, load, input/output information and status that automations can use for alerts or shutdown orchestration.
Pure sine wave can matter for some power supplies
Many modern active-PFC PC power supplies behave best with a pure-sine or high-quality simulated waveform during battery operation. A small wall-wart Home Assistant appliance is less demanding, but a Proxmox server or workstation-class GPU host deserves closer attention. Choose waveform quality based on the most sensitive equipment protected, not because every smart-home device requires a premium sine-wave UPS.
Battery replacement is part of ownership cost
UPS lead-acid batteries age even if power outages are rare. Heat shortens life, and a unit can report healthy status while delivering much less runtime years later. Put the replacement date in your maintenance notes, test battery operation periodically and avoid hiding the UPS in a hot sealed cabinet. Long-term reliability depends on the battery being serviceable when the outage finally occurs.
Graceful shutdown should start before the battery is empty
If the UPS is intended to protect a Proxmox or Home Assistant host through longer outages, define when shutdown begins. Waiting until a battery reports almost zero leaves little margin for battery aging or load variation. NUT status can feed automation or host-side shutdown logic, but the critical action should not depend on a complicated chain of optional smart-home automations.
Separate critical and noncritical loads when useful
A large surveillance system may make it expensive to keep every camera and switch powered for an hour. You can instead define a critical UPS domain for Home Assistant, router, core switch and essential radios, while high-draw devices use shorter-runtime protection or shut down earlier. This makes battery capacity work for the functions that actually need continuous availability.
The buying sequence is measure, size, then compare
Add server watts, network watts, critical PoE load and any other equipment. Decide whether you need brief ride-through or sustained operation. Keep margin under the UPS watt limit, calculate a conservative minimum energy requirement and then consult the runtime curve for the exact UPS model. Finally compare current price, battery replacement availability, USB/NUT compatibility and warranty rather than selecting solely by VA.
Questions people ask
Best UPS for Home Assistant questions
What size UPS does Home Assistant need?
It depends on the total protected watts and desired runtime. Small appliance systems may fit 600–1000VA class units; Proxmox/PoE systems often need more.
Does a 1500VA UPS run twice as long as a 750VA UPS?
Not necessarily. VA is not battery runtime. Compare watt rating, battery capacity and the manufacturer runtime curve at your actual load.
Should my router be on the UPS?
Yes if Home Assistant depends on the network during an outage. Protect the critical network path, not only the server.
Should a PoE switch be on the UPS?
Yes when the powered devices are required during outages, but include their PoE consumption in the load calculation.
Can Home Assistant monitor a UPS?
Yes through the Network UPS Tools integration when a NUT server and compatible UPS driver expose the data.
Does Home Assistant connect directly to every USB UPS?
The NUT integration connects to a NUT server. The driver/server layer still needs to communicate with the physical UPS.
Do I need pure sine wave?
It is worth considering for active-PFC servers and workstation hardware. Small wall-wart appliances may be less sensitive.
How much UPS headroom should I leave?
Avoid sizing at the watt limit. Cloudzat’s calculator uses a conservative margin and then requires checking the model’s runtime curve.
How often should UPS batteries be replaced?
Battery life varies with chemistry, heat and cycling. Monitor condition and plan periodic replacement according to the manufacturer and actual test results.
Can I keep Frigate cameras on the same UPS?
Yes, but camera PoE load can dominate runtime. Include worst-case PoE power and consider separating critical/noncritical loads.
